The eyes are the central focus of human interaction, making eyelid rejuvenation essential for restoring a vibrant, youthful gaze. Blepharoplasty revitalizes the eyes by addressing sagging skin, puffiness, and aging contours.
Upper Blepharoplasty
Goal: Remove excess skin from the upper eyelids, which can droop over the lash line or impair vision.
Result: A more open, alert eye appearance and overall facial rejuvenation—often eliminating the need for more invasive procedures.
Lower Blepharoplasty
Goal: Correct under-eye “bags” (common in patients with genetic predisposition) and tighten loose skin.
Technique: Precise removal of fat and skin while preserving the eye’s natural almond shape.
- Avoid over-resection of fat to prevent a hollow, sunken appearance.
- Combine with micro-fat grafting (using the patient’s own fat) to restore volume below the eyes for seamless rejuvenation.
